New account username- unable to use special characters, is this a bug?

When setting up a new user account on 

https://www.splunk.com/page/sign_up

the Username field and FAQ say that you can enter your Email or Username.

But the field cannot contain @ or . characters hence cannot accept a valid email.

Example below with "a." being 'invalid'.

You can enter underscores _

Is this inconsistency a bug?
